Finding Reputable Canadian Online Pharmacies: Verification Tips

Check the pharmacy’s registration with your provincial regulatory body. Each province maintains a list of licensed pharmacies; verify the online pharmacy is listed.

Look for a physical address and contact information. Legitimate pharmacies will openly display their location and contact details, including a phone number you can readily call.

Examine the website’s security features. Secure sites use HTTPS (indicated by a padlock icon in your browser’s address bar). Avoid pharmacies lacking this security measure.

Scrutinize the pharmacy’s privacy policy. A strong policy details how they handle your personal and medical information, ensuring your data is protected.

Read online reviews from independent sources. While not definitive proof, consistent positive reviews from multiple sources suggest higher reliability.

Verify the pharmacist’s licensing information. Reputable pharmacies will provide details about the licensed pharmacists who oversee operations.

Beware of unusually low prices. Significantly cheaper medication often indicates counterfeit or substandard products. Prices should be comparable to those at brick-and-mortar pharmacies.

Confirm the pharmacy’s accreditation. Look for accreditations from recognized organizations like the Canadian International Pharmacy Association (CIPA).

Check the website’s terms and conditions. A clear and straightforward terms and conditions page speaks to transparency.

If unsure, consult your doctor or pharmacist. They can offer guidance on identifying reliable online pharmacies.

Potential Risks and Precautions When Ordering Online

Always verify the online pharmacy’s legitimacy. Check if they’re registered with your provincial regulatory body and possess a valid license. Look for a physical address and contact information readily available on their website.

Verify Drug Authenticity

Counterfeit medications pose a serious threat. Confirm the pharmacy sources drugs from reputable manufacturers. Examine the packaging carefully for any signs of tampering or inconsistencies. If something seems off, contact the pharmacy directly for clarification before consuming any medication.

Secure Your Personal Information

Ensure the website uses HTTPS (the padlock symbol in your browser’s address bar) to encrypt your data. Avoid pharmacies that request unnecessary personal information. Read their privacy policy carefully to understand how they handle your data. Never share your credit card details with suspicious websites.
